
Our Mission
"The goal of the West Lafayette Go Greener Commission is to promote and enhance sustainable environmental well-being within the City of West Lafayette and among its residents for present and future generations. The commission strives to gather and disseminate sustainability focused information, plan and promote practical sustainability-focused initiatives and public policies, and measure, monitor, and report on the City of West Lafayette’s progress on sustainability."
Who We Are
The West Lafayette Go Greener Commission was established by the City Council in 2008 to highlight and boost green efforts in the City. This site has information for community members interested in learning more about the Commission's efforts and initiatives. Anyone in the West Lafayette / Tippecanoe County region can apply to be a member of Go Greener.
